Histoire de Henri II plonge le lecteur dans le règne tumultueux et fascinant d’Henri II, roi de France au XVIe siècle. Cet ouvrage explore les complexités politiques, les intrigues de cour et les guerres qui ont marqué son règne. À travers une analyse détaillée, le lecteur découvre les enjeux cruciaux de cette période de la Renaissance française. Nicolas Edouard Delabarre-Duparcq offre une perspective riche et documentée sur un monarque dont l’influence a façonné l’histoire de France.
